  1. F. D. Roosevelt High School April 11 th , 2019 District Mission: The Hyde Park Central School District empowers our community to strive for excellence and embrace the opportunities of our globally connected world. Building Mission: We are committed to fostering confident individuals with a passion for learning who demonstrate responsible behavior as young leaders within their community. Our Goal: Graduate More Students Decide to Cause that to Happen

Roosevelt High School AP & College Credit Courses: • 18 AP Classes, 5 DCC, 4 Marist, & 1 SUNY Albany Course • PLTW: Students can potentially earn up to 18 RIT Credits Continuing our “At Risk” Protocol & Meetings (AIS) Academic Intervention Services 136 Students Attend Dutchess BOCES Career & Technical Institute. Students First FDR Critical Thinking & Writing. Regents Prep Prior to the August, January, and June Regents exams Summer School: Targeted at upper classmen at risk for graduation & Freshmen failures in core subjects

  5. F. D. Roosevelt High School The 4 Cs: Critical Thinking, Collaboration, Creativity, and Communication with particular emphasis on critical thinking and higher order questioning. AVID (Advancement via Individual Determination): Increased training in best practices and supportive implementation. Increase Use of Technology 1:1 Initiative, Hardware & Supporting Training. English Curriculum Alignment with Colleges and Careers. Continued Expectation of the Daily Agenda in Each Classroom:  Date, Standard, Objective, Opening, Work Period, Closing & Homework Sources of Strength to address issues relating to emotional safety and support. Culturally Responsive Teaching. Common Planning Time and Data Review. Project Lead the Way (PLTW). PBIS.
